Welcome to Briskoda. :D I wouldn't read too much into the trip computer fuel readings. Brim the tank, record the mileage, brim again when nearly empty then calculate actual fuel consumption. Zero Trip 2 at the start of the exercise and check the overall fuel comsumption figure recorded against the actual fuel consumption.

Those 'distance to go' readings are only a guide and are calculated dynamically based on your current consumption so if you were for instance doing a steady speed on a motorway for a fair few miles and your consumption was reasonable it would be reflected in the 'distance to go' however, stuck in traffic and doing 20 or so to the gallon will have the reverse affect.
